Crandon, WI vs Endeavor, WI
Crandon is moderately more affordable than Endeavor, with a 5.9% lower cost of living index. Crandon scores 62 compared to 66 for Endeavor,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Endeavor can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.
On the housing front, median rent in Crandon is $597/month compared to $714/month in Endeavor — a 16%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Crandon is more affordable at $129,400 median vs $133,700.
Median household income in Crandon is $50,729 compared to $53,365 in Endeavor (-4.9%). The higher salaries in Endeavor partially offset the cost difference, but don't fully close the gap. Looking at affordability, residents of Crandon spend roughly 14.1% of their income on rent, less than the 16.1% in Endeavor.
